Define a regression rate temperature sensitivity factor. The sensitivity parameter is in the range of 0.06-0.18 %/K for composite propellants. Can be higher for double base propellants. Temperature sensitivity is important since the thrust time profile changes with changing temperature.

The largest solid rocket motors ever built were Aerojet's three 6.60-meter (260 in) monolithic solid motors cast in Florida. [16] Motors 260 SL-1 and SL-2 were 6.63 meters (261 in) in diameter, 24.59 meters (80 ft 8 in) long, weighed 842,900 kilograms (1,858,300 lb), and had a maximum thrust of 16 MN (3,500,000 lbf).
A solid rocket motor consists of a high energy propellant grain stored within an inert combustion chamber capable of withstanding high pressure and high tem- perature conditions.
"Solid Rocket Propulsion" - Purdue University
Thrust is developed as the high thermal energy of the combustion gases is converted to kinetic energy in the exhaust. The simplicity of SRMs make them an attractive choice for many rocket propulsion applications.
